Ned Capital is seeking an experienced Non-Executive Director to join its fast-growing legal services group in Shropshire. The role requires strong board-level judgement and a deep understanding of legal regulations, with a focus on M&A and governance.
Candidates should be qualified solicitors or barristers with senior leadership experience, able to commit 1-2 days per month, including hybrid working and regular in-person meetings.
